It had been a long, indecisive day. The angry mob nearly turned on itself as tensions heightened and bickering nearly turned into fistfights - or worse. They were growing desperate. The frequency of deaths was only increasing, and it was only a matter of time before one of them was next.

At last, however, a decision had been reached. The mob now trekked deep into the forest, deeper even than they had ventured to find that well in the clearing. The embers of dozens of torches danced through the air, threatening to burn the entire landscape to the ground, but nothing caught. Even the trees knew how critical it was that they get this one right.

The light from overhead faded, leaving the torches as their only guide. They knew there had been a slight risk of this, given how late in the afternoon they had set out. Still, they pressed onwards, undeterred by the oncoming darkness.

After an indeterminate length of time, the mob emerged into a clearing. In the middle of the clearing was a simple wooden shack. The landscape was not nearly as dark as some might expect - the brilliant full moon hanging in the sky was doing an excellent job of competing with the mob's torches for title of top illuminator. There was something... unsettling about the scene. The voices of the mob faded, and the only sound left was that of the gentle breeze whispering through the moonlit grass.

That, and... something else.

A faint noise, coming from inside the cabin. A sort of frenzied scratching. Whatever it was, it didn't sound human.

The townsfolk exchanged glances. Nobody really wanted to go inside that cabin. It wasn't, however, a matter of want. It was a matter of necessity. Someone near the front was the first to break free of his paralysis and take a tentative step forward, and soon the entire mass of people was slowly treading towards the innocuous-looking cabin.

The scratching was not letting up. If anything, it was getting louder, more erratic, more... animalistic.

The first person to reach the door hesitated. She knew this was a bad idea. She knew bad things were going to happen the second she opened that door.

And then she did it anyways. And what was inside the door was a horrible sight to behold.

A large, hairy man sat stark naked on a stool, furiously scratching at his back with a makeshift backscratcher. Once again, the townsfolk exchanged glances. This isn't QUITE what they had expected.

Hanging on the wall next to the man, however, was a bloodstained axe and an impressive collection of rifles, as well as what appeared to be a human arm.

This was all the proof they needed. When the sun returned to the clearing, nothing remained of the cabin except ashes.

The laws of nature are essentially set in stone. The strongest survive; the weakest don't. The predator consumes the prey. Concepts such as "murder" don't exist. It's a simpler world, one that's been around for thousands upon thousands of years.

The hunter told herself this on a daily basis. It was more to justify her actions to herself than to anyone else; she knew she wouldn't be able to live with herself should she phrase her actions any other way.

Hers was a simple lifestyle, to accompany a simple philosophy. She would wake up with the sun each morning and check her traps, hoping to catch some breakfast. A squirrel was good, but a rabbit was better. A rabbit would tide her over until she was able to clean out her rifle and head out into the woods. That's when the REAL hunt would begin.

The evening was a flurry of butchering and preparing the various meats she had obtained throughout the course of the day. She wasn't sure if she was simply a crack shot, or if the forest was absolutely flooded with edible life, but it seemed as if every shot from her rifle was a direct hit. She certainly wasn't going to question this good fortune.

The routine had been different that day. She had woken up before the sun - not out of any irregularity in sleep schedule, but due to a faint but persistent noise from outside. She grabbed her rifle, skipping her usual cleaning process, but it didn't matter - the door to her home had finally been broken down.

As she saw the sawed-off shotgun in her face, she realized this was only good and right. After all, only the strong survive.
